How To Make the 'Squid Game' Sugar Honeycomb at Home

Made popular by the Netflix hit, the traditional Korean treat requires only two ingredients.

As Squid Game races to the top of Netflix charts around the world, the dystopian series’ sugar honeycomb challenge — featured in episode 3 “The Man With the Umbrella” — has become a trending topic across social media platforms, especially on TikTok.

While you may know the sugar honeycomb challenge from the smash-hit Netflix drama, it is actually a classic game that most Koreans will remember from their childhood. The snack, also known as dalgona or ppopgi, is typically sold near schools where kids will spend their pocket money. After choosing a shape, you are given a chance to eat around the pattern without breaking the honeycomb. If you make it through the challenge, vendors will usually reward you with another dalgona or even small toys.

Ingredients

Dalgona is a simple snack that requires only two ingredients to make.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• 3 tablespoons of sugar
  • A pinch of baking soda

Preparation

1. Heat the sugar in a metal ladle or a small pan until caramelized. Make sure to keep stirring with a wooden chopstick to prevent the sugar from burning.

2. Once the sugar turns into a caramel brown color, add a pinch of baking soda and continue to stir.

3. Turn off the heat once the mixture reaches a golden beige color.

4. Pour the sugar onto a baking sheet.

5. Wait a few seconds. Just before the sugar is about to set, flatten the mixture with a round disc or pan.

6. Use a cutter to create a design or shape of your choice.
